Yes, it doesn’t actually “save” in the same meaning of the word, it only updates the edited footprint to the board design without saving it. The confusing part is to re-use the “Save” function to do that.

I suppose it should be renamed “update”.

But:

There is a big yellow sign warning update only.
There are “save” prompts when closing both the FP editor and the PCB editor.
The user experiencing the problem was using a very old version of Kicad that crashed before the PCB editor “save” could be used. This crashing may well have been a “long ago” fixed bug; as following the same work method as the OP in 6.0.0 no longer causes freezing followed by a crash.
